WebThis review highlights the steps involved in melanogenesis in the epidermis and the disorders in skin pigmentation that occur when specific steps critical for this process are defective. Melanosomes, which contain tyrosinase, a major enzyme involved in melanin synthesis, develop through a series of steps in the melanocyte. Webmelanocyte, specialized skin cell that produces the protective skin-darkening pigment melanin. Birds and mammals possess these pigment cells, which are found mainly in the epidermis, though they occur elsewhere—e.g., in the matrix of the hair.
